Toyota just announced pricing for the 2013 Avalon. This all-new premium sedan starts at $30,990, excluding $795 for destination and delivery.

Insiders have revealed that Mercedes-Benz is testing banana wood as a trim on the next S-Class and that all wood veneers are 100 percent real. Exotic materials such as silk and cashmere are also being considered. The current S-Class is becoming somewhat long-in-the-tooth, compared to the recently released Audi A8 and BMW 7-Series.
